На моем MacBook Pro я использовал HomeBrew для установки новой версии Apache и PHP. Проблема, с которой я сейчас сталкиваюсь, заключается в том, что у меня проблема в моем файле конфигурации apache, так что файлы php не запускаются модулем PHP, а просто отображаются как необработанный текст
Вот мой файл test.php:
<!DOCTYPE HTML5>
<HTML>
<BODY>
<?php
echo "PHP Active!";
?>
</BODY>
</HTML>
Когда я открываю его в Safari, он показывает все (необработанное) содержимое файла, тег и все остальное.
В моем файле HTTPD.conf у меня есть
LoadModule php_module /usr/local/opt/php/lib/httpd/modules/libphp.so
И
<FilesMatch .php$>
SetHandler application/x-httpd-php
</FilesMatch>
Опять же, то, что я вижу в Safari, в точности совпадает с текстом в файле.